Turnkey cable carrier system allows efficient and safe operation of a container crane

A cable carrier from KABELSCHLEPP successfully resolved the problems with a container crane at the terminal of Contargo Rhein-Neckar GmbH in Ludwigshafen.


Several ship-to-shore loading cranes ensure smooth transport of the containers between ships and land at the terminal in Ludwigshafen around the clock. One of the container cranes, or rather the cable carrier used, was no longer capable of meeting the high requirements, though: It required weekly maintenance which meant downtimes and breakdown costs. The cable carrier also produced an extreme noise level.


Contargo started looking for a new cable carrier and decided to work with KABELSCHLEPP. The company in Ludwigshafen was particularly impressed by the proposed significant noise reduction and the well thought out design of the system. KABELSCHLEPP implemented a turnkey system consisting of an MC1300 cable carrier including cable package as well as a guide channel with swiveling covers and climbing protection. The latter provides the desired easy maintenance and good protection against weather influence. The overall package also included project planning and installation.


“We are fully satisfied with the new system and with the cooperation with KABELSCHLEPP,” Andreas Roer, Managing Director of Contargo Rhein-Neckar GmbH, confirms. “The new cable carrier runs very quietly compared to its predecessor. The well thought out housing design also met with all our expectations.”
